Photosynthetic characteristics of wild-type (Ws-2, Col-0) and mutant plants defective in the TPT and XPT. In (A) false-colour images of Fo and the Fv/Fm-ratios are displayed for plants grown for 20 days under LL- (PFD = 30 μmol⋅m-2⋅s-1) or for 12 days under HL-conditions (PFD = 300 μmol⋅m-2⋅s-1) in the long-day, or for 43 days under SL-conditions (PFD = 150 μmol⋅m-2⋅s-1) in the short-day. For the latter details of the fluorescence distribution or of Fv/Fm-ratios are depicted (lower panel). In (B,C) induction and light curves, respectively, of relative ETR are shown for wild-type plants, the xpt-1, tpt-1, and tpt-2 single mutants as well as for tpt-1/xpt-1, and tpt-2/xpt-1 double mutants and an amiRNA:XPT overexpressor in the tpt-2 background grown under HL-conditions. The actinic light during the induction of photosynthesis was set to a PFD of 281 μmol⋅m-2⋅s-1. As an additional control the adg1-1/tpt-2 double mutant was included in this experiment.
